开发者最佳实践11 – 职业规划

如今的职业生活是多变的,要跟上这样的变化我们需要适当的职业规划。

当你开始你的软件编程职业生涯时,你可能还不知道你在这个行业里会有怎样的表现,虽然你相信不论你做什么都能以最好的方式完成。

所以,花些时间了解你自己,你的长处和短处是什么,基于你3-4年的工作经验,你有些不同的选择:

  • 你想永远做个软件开发人员吗?这可能是一个很好的选择,有很多人热爱一直编码。
  • 如果你非常善于设计软件模块并且你过去的设计得到很多赞赏,那么你可以考虑技术方向,成为一名首席架构师。
  • 如果你擅于管理事情,有很好的指挥他人的能力,有说服力,那么你可以往管理角色方向发展,可以从带领一个小团队开始。
  • 你可能擅于管理事情,有时候还有好多架构感,那可以考虑做技术主管,这样你可以继续从事设计工作,同时管理团队和项目。

不论怎样,你必须要清楚你想去哪儿。

一旦你确定你的目标,你应该开始朝测个方向努力,从你的工作到培训和资历认证。你现在的组织可能没有给你合适机会去达到你渴望的目的地,你可以等待合适的时机并跳槽到一个好的组织,但是不要过于频繁。我曾经见过有些家伙像猴子一样,每6个月都从一个组织跳到另一个组织,只是因为离家稍远,事情或者计划不如意,可是他们不知道从长远来看他们失去了什么。

你可以和你的主管或部门经理讨论你的职业道路,大部分组织有为员工设计标准的职业道路,因此你可以据此来判断是否适合你的兴趣并为此努力。

什么时候跳槽?

我什么时候应该跳槽到另一个组织?这是个非常有趣的问题,但是我无法用简单的几句话来回答。

你清楚你的职业道路,如果你当前的组织能够让你达到你的目标,那么你为什么想要离开呢。

只是因为几美元而离开一个组织可不是个好理由,而且频繁跳槽也不是个好主意,即使你将获得不错的升职和大幅加薪。原因很简单,这样你就是在丧失你的信誉,将不会有好的公司信赖你,因为你一直在看重金钱和职位,谁知道你什么时候会离开他们。

如果你在组织里有些内部的HR或者管理方面的问题,尝试解决他们,因为你不知道你的下一家公司是否会有比现在更严重的问题。你可以和你的主管、经理或者HR沟通,优雅地解决这些问题。

如果你在现在的公司没有成长空间和好的职业选择,同时你的学习曲线达到饱和,那就是时间跳槽到另外一个组织了。也可能有这种情况,在现在的公司没有富裕的薪资和好的职位,但是你能学到很多,这些能给你的履历和职业生涯增加很多价值,那最好是坚持到你的学习结束。

注:本文由奔跑翻译,前往查看原文

版权申明:

本站保留所有原创文章的版权,本站地址:奔跑的博客[http://www.elecbench.com]

原创文章转载时请注明出处,并添加文章所在页面的链接:https://www.elecbench.com/1541/

本站所有 2010年3月4日 以后发表、未标明为“转载”的文章均是本站原创。

发表评论


(设置自己的个性头像)

申请属于你的免费顶级域名